Cheat sheet – Which AI to use for what?

 

Model Application case Advantage
ChatGPT For short, precise and stylish answers Fast, smart and very reliable
Claude For longer conversations or extensive documents Thoughtful tone, good for large contexts; Opus 4 for tempo, Sonnet 4 for deep thought
Google Gemini Multimodal Analysis (Images, Video, Code) Strong in large data sets and complex research
Calls Full control over the model Locally operable – used by us when data should remain in the country
Perplexity AI One for all: Automatic model selection depending on the task Selects the appropriate model independently (e.g. GPT, Claude, Gemini)

 

Questions about: Basics of Artificial Intelligence:

 

🎲 Question 1: How does an AI really “think”?
A: She meditates in a digital lotus position.
B: It calculates probabilities for each possible next word and selects the word with the highest probability.
C: She reads the minds of everyone on the Internet.

✅ Correct answer: B

💡 Explanation: The AI determines probabilities for each next token based on its training and selects the token with the highest probability to generate coherent and appropriate texts.

🤖 Question 2: What is an LLM (Large Language Model)?
A: An artificial intelligence that behaves like a smart friend during small talk.
B: A long-distance run for computers.
C: A machine that writes texts but has no idea what it is saying.

✅ Correct answer: A and C are both correct – depending on your perspective 😉

💡 Explanation: An LLM processes huge amounts of text, recognizes patterns and generates appropriate answers – but without real understanding.

💥 Question 3: Which of these things can an LLM not do?
A: Have feelings
B: Knowing what is true
C: Help with moving

✅ Correct answer: A, B and C

💡 Explanation: An LLM has no feelings, no real understanding of truth and definitely no arms.
